sourcepub fn global_table_name(&self) -> Option<&str>
pub fn global_table_name(&self) -> Option<&str>
The name of the global table
sourcepub fn global_table_billing_mode(&self) -> Option<&BillingMode>
pub fn global_table_billing_mode(&self) -> Option<&BillingMode>
The billing mode of the global table. If GlobalTableBillingMode
is not specified, the global table defaults to PROVISIONED
capacity billing mode.
-
PROVISIONED
- We recommend usingPROVISIONED
for predictable workloads.PROVISIONED
sets the billing mode to Provisioned Mode. -
PAY_PER_REQUEST
- We recommend usingPAY_PER_REQUEST
for unpredictable workloads.PAY_PER_REQUEST
sets the billing mode to On-Demand Mode.
sourcepub fn global_table_provisioned_write_capacity_units(&self) -> Option<i64>
pub fn global_table_provisioned_write_capacity_units(&self) -> Option<i64>
The maximum number of writes consumed per second before DynamoDB returns a ThrottlingException.
